ISSUE N.01 (OCT/NOV 2020): Security

In consideration of and in response to the global health crisis, novel facets of the concept of security in international relations have emerged and have been rediscovered in 2020.

The first ever issue of TNGO is a collection of selected articles, analyses, and interviews published by the think tank in the period October-November 2020, encompassing challenges of human security – such as the uninterrupted migratory flows in the Mediterranean Sea – as well as issues of cyber- and data security, health security, geopolitical and resource security.

ISSUE N.02 (FEB/APR 2021): Rise of Illiberal Democracy

With the COVID-19 pandemic challenging polities through an economic recession and growing political tensions, the spread and rise of illiberal democracy have continued throughout the first half of 2021.

The second-ever issue of TNGO is a collection of selected articles and analyses published by the think tank in the period February-April 2021, encompassing political trajectories of democracies worldwide in the struggle between the pitfalls endangering civil and political liberties and widespread reactions from civil society.
